STM32F412CGU6

STM32F412XE/G devices are based on the high-performance Arm® Cortex® -M4 32-bit
RISC core operating at a frequency of up to 100 MHz. Their Cortex®-M4 core features a
Floating point unit (FPU) single precision which supports all Arm single-precision dataprocessing instructions and data types. It also implements a full set of DSP instructions and
a memory protection unit (MPU) which enhances application security.
STM32F412XE/G devices belong to the STM32 Dynamic Efficiency™ product line (with
products combining power efficiency, performance and integration) while adding a new
innovative feature called Batch Acquisition Mode (BAM) allowing even more power
consumption saving during data batching.
STM32F412XE/G devices incorporate high-speed embedded memories (up to 1 Mbyte of
flash memory, 256 Kbytes of SRAM), and an extensive range of enhanced I/Os and
peripherals connected to two APB buses, three AHB buses and a 32-bit multi-AHB bus
matrix.
All devices offer one 12-bit ADC, a low-power RTC, twelve general-purpose 16-bit timers,
two PWM timers for motor control and two general-purpose 32-bit timers.
They also feature standard and advanced communication interfaces:
– Up to four I2Cs, including one I2C supporting Fast-Mode Plus
– Five SPIs
– Five I2Ss of which two are full duplex. To achieve audio class accuracy, the I2S peripherals
can be clocked via a dedicated internal audio PLL, or via an external clock to allow
synchronization.
– Four USARTs
– An SDIO/MMC interface
– A USB 2.0 OTG full-speed interface
– Two CANs.
In addition, STM32F412xE/G devices embed advanced peripherals:
– A flexible static memory controller interface (FSMC)
– A Quad-SPI memory interface
– A digital filter for sigma modulator (DFSDM), two filters, up to four inputs, and support of
microphone MEMs.
STM32F412xE/G devices are offered in 7 packages ranging from 48 to 144 pins. The set of
available peripherals depends on the selected package.
The STM32F412xE/G operates in the -40 to +125 °C temperature range from a 1.7 (PDR
OFF) to 3.6 V power supply. A comprehensive set of power-saving modes allows the design
of low-power applications.

    SPECIFICATION

    • Includes ST state-of-the-art patented
    technology
    • Dynamic efficiency line with BAM (Batch
    acquisition mode)
    • Core: Arm® 32-bit Cortex®-M4 CPU with FPU,
    Adaptive real-time accelerator (ART
    Accelerator™) allowing 0-wait state execution
    from flash memory, frequency up to 100 MHz,
    memory protection unit,
    125 DMIPS/1.25 DMIPS/MHz (Dhrystone 2.1),
    and DSP instructions
    • Memories
    – Up to 1 Mbyte of flash memory
    – 256 Kbytes of SRAM
    – Flexible external static memory controller
    with up to 16-bit data bus: SRAM, PSRAM,
    NOR flash memory
    – Dual mode Quad-SPI interface
    • LCD parallel interface, 8080/6800 modes
    • Clock, reset and supply management
    – 1.7 V to 3.6 V application supply and I/Os
    – POR, PDR, PVD and BOR
    – 4-to-26 MHz crystal oscillator
    – Internal 16 MHz factory-trimmed RC
    – 32 kHz oscillator for RTC with calibration
    – Internal 32 kHz RC with calibration
    • Power consumption
    – Run: 112 µA/MHz (peripheral off)
    – Stop (Flash in Stop mode, fast wakeup
    time): 50 µA typical at 25 °C; 75 µA max at
    25 °C
    – Stop (flash memory in Deep power down
    mode, slow wakeup time): down to 18 µA
    at 25 °C; 40 µA max at 25 °C
    – Standby: 2.4 µA at 25 °C / 1.7 V without
    RTC; 12 µA at 85 °C at 1.7 V
    – VBAT supply for RTC: 1 µA at 25 °C
    1×12-bit, 2.4 MSPS ADC: up to 16
    channels
    • 2x digital filters for sigma delta modulator,
    4x PDM interfaces, stereo microphone support
    • General-purpose DMA: 16-stream DMA
    • Up to 17 timers: up to twelve 16-bit timers, two
    32-bit timers up to 100 MHz each with up to
    four IC/OC/PWM or pulse counter and
    quadrature (incremental) encoder input, two
    watchdog timers (independent and window),
    one SysTick timer
    • Debug mode
    – Serial wire debug (SWD) and JTAG
    – Cortex®-M4 Embedded Trace Macrocell™
    • Up to 114 I/O ports with interrupt capability
    – Up to 109 fast I/Os up to 100 MHz
    – Up to 114 five V-tolerant I/Os
    • Up to 17 communication interfaces
    – Up to 4x I2C interfaces (SMBus/PMBus)
    – Up to 4 USARTs (2 x 12.5 Mbit/s,
    2 x 6.25 Mbit/s), ISO 7816 interface, LIN,
    IrDA, modem control)
    – Up to 5 SPI/I2Ss (up to 50 Mbit/s, SPI or
    I2S audio protocol), out of which 2 muxed
    full-duplex I2S interfaces
    – SDIO interface (SD/MMC/eMMC)
    – Advanced connectivity: USB 2.0 full-speed
    device/host/OTG controller with PHY
    – 2x CAN (2.0B Active)
    • True random number generator
    • CRC calculation unit
    • 96-bit unique ID
    • RTC: subsecond accuracy, hardware calendar
    • All packages are ECOPACK2 compliant
